Description

Oberheim TEO 5 is a modern instrument, a 5-voice (2 VCO, sub osc per voice) polyphonic analog synth with X-Mod (FM) equipped with a 3.5-octave (44-key) semi-weighted Fatar Premium keyboard, sensitive to velocity and aftertouch. The filter is a variable state SEM (lowpass, highpass, notch, and bandpass). The modulation matrix is rich and articulate. There are 2 24-bit/48kHz digital effects processors: one dedicated exclusively to reverb (room, hall, plate, spring) and another to effects such as delay, chorus, flanger, Oberheim phase shifter and ring modulator emulations. Stereo analog overdrive. 2 LFOs, 2 assignable ADSRs. Arpeggiator and 64-step polyphonic sequencer with ties and rests.

Oberheim TEO-5 Features

- 5-voice polysynth based on VCO/VCF

- 2x VCOs and sub oscillator per voice

- Simultaneously selectable waveforms for each oscillator: triangle, sawtooth, variable pulse

- Oscillator 1 syncs with oscillator 2

- Dedicated X-Mod control on the front panel for FM 

- Switchable key tracking per oscillator

- White noise generator accessible in the pre-filter mixer

STATE-VARIABLE FILTER

- Classic SEM-style filter with selectable Band-Pass mode

- State knob continuously sweeps from Low-Pass to Notch to High-Pass

- Bi-polar filter envelope amount

- Velocity modulation of envelope amount

- Keyboard tracking

FILTER ENVELOPE

- Five-stage envelope generator (DADSR)

- Velocity modulation of envelope amount

AMPLIFIER ENVELOPE

- Five-stage envelope generator (DADSR)

- Velocity modulation of envelope amount

2 LFOs (LOW FREQUENCY OSCILLATORS)

- Five waveforms: triangle, sawtooth, reverse sawtooth, square, and random (sample and hold)

- BPM synchronization

- Initial amount setting

- Freely assignable modulation destinations

THE VINTAGE KNOB on the Oberheim TEO 5

- Recreates vintage synth characteristics by adding voice-to-voice variations in component behavior

AFTERTOUCH

- Channel (mono) aftertouch with bi-polar amount

- Freely assignable modulation destinations

CLOCK

- Main clock with tap tempo

- BPM control and display

- MIDI clock synchronization

ARPEGGIATOR

- Selectable note value: sixteenth, eighth triplet, eighth, dotted eighth, quarter

- Range of one, two, or three octaves

- Up, down, up/down, random, and assign mode

SEQUENCER

- 64-step polyphonic sequencer, including ties and rests

EFFECTS

- Stereo analog overdrive

- Two 24-bit, 48 kHz digital effects, including: reverb (room, hall, plate, spring), delay (digital and bucket brigade delay), chorus, flanger, Oberheim phase shifter and ring modulator emulations.

- BPM synchronization 

- True bypass maintains a fully analog signal path when digital effects are off

PERFORMANCE CONTROLS

- Hold switch sustains held notes

- Polyphonic portamento

- Unison (monophonic) mode with configurable voice count, from one to all five voices, and key modes to control voice triggering priority

PATCH MEMORIES

- 256 user programs and 256 factory programs in 32 banks of 16 programs each

- Direct program access, including one-button access to the current set of 16 programs

Oberheim TEO-5 Connections

- Left (mono) and right (2 x 1/4" jacks) audio outputs

- Headphone output (stereo, 1/4" jack)

- MIDI In, Out, and Thru ports

- USB for bi-directional MIDI communication

- Volume expression pedal input

- Sustain pedal input

POWER SUPPLY

- AC IEC input 

- Operates worldwide with voltages between 100 and 240 volts at 50-60 Hz; maximum consumption of 30 watts

PHYSICAL SPECIFICATIONS

- 3.5-octave Fatar semi-weighted premium keyboard

- Dimensions and weight: 63.5x32.4x11.2cm; 7.7KG
